Earley to Wallasey Village by train

A train trip from Earley to Wallasey Village takes about 5hrs 31 mins on average, covering roughly 164 miles (264 kilometres). With around 29 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£38.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

What are my cheap ticket options for Earley to Wallasey Village journeys?

From booking in Advance, to our FairSplits, here are our tips for you to find the best price

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Earley to Wallasey Village start from as little as £38.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Earley to Wallasey Village start from £89.30 one way, or £127.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Earley to Wallasey Village are available for £122.10 one way, or £244.00 return

Facilities at Earley Station

Earley Station provides a variety of essential facilities to make your journey smooth and hassle-free. The ticket office is open from 6:05 AM to 1:25 PM on weekdays and offers adjusted times over the weekend and holidays. There are also ticket machines available for quick transactions and ticket collection, including options for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ard discount.

Accessibility is a priority at Earley, with step-free access available to Platform 1, catering to trains towards Reading. However, be aware that Platform 2, serving London-bound trains, does have steps. For assistance needs, customer help points are present, though there is no staff help directly at the station. Should you need anything beyond the basics, it's good to note there are no refreshment facilities or shops on the premises, so plan accordingly.

Exploring Onward Travel Options

Efficient transport links extend the convenience of Earley Station beyond its platforms. Local bus services can be accessed at Wokingham Road (A329), further enhancing your connectivity. A downloadable guide is available here to assist with journey planning.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Wallasey Village Station, located in Merseyside, is a key transport hub, known for its straightforward services and essential amenities. The station is equipped with a ticket office that operates from early morning until late at night, perfect for those who prefer human interaction when purchasing tickets. However, it's important to note that there are no ticket machines, so be prepared to collect tickets purchased online from the ticket office.

While modern conveniences like smartcard validators are present, the station doesn't offer much by way of refreshment facilities, shopping, or even an ATM machine, making it a good idea to prepare beforehand for any journeys. One should also be aware that there is no step-free access to platforms, which may require additional planning for travelers with mobility issues. The nearest disability-friendly station is New Brighton.

Onward Travel Options

Despite its cozy size, Wallasey Village Station connects well with various modes of transportation. Although there is no taxi rank directly at the station, visitors can explore local bus options. For local journey planning, one can easily access information via this link or contact the Traveline. For those heading further afield,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is conveniently linked by rail and bus. You can purchase an inclusive ticket that will cover both train and bus portions when planning your trip to the airport.
